What’s the minimum amount qualification to be a swim teacher in Australia?
In Australia, the most recognised qualification is really an AUSTSWIM Instructor of Swimming and H2o Basic safety Licence — the gold regular across the nation. It’s trustworthy by educational facilities, councils, and aquatic centres as it combines both equally useful training and theoretical know-how.
To make it, you’ll really need to:
Be at the least 16 several years old (while you can start teaching earlier).
Comprehensive an AUSTSWIM-accredited coaching study course covering drinking water safety, educating methods, and unexpected emergency reaction.
Hold a latest CPR certificate from a recognised service provider.
Undertake useful supervised training hours — generally 20 hrs underneath a qualified mentor.
This certification isn’t merely a tick-box exercise. It makes sure that each individual swim teacher has the abilities to show safely, talk Evidently, and handle teams correctly — whether they’re coaching toddlers or Grownups rediscovering the h2o.

How long does it consider to qualify?
It is possible to commonly entire your swim Trainer course in 6–8 weeks, based on the supplier along with your plan. Some finish it a lot quicker through intensive weekend blocks.
Here’s what’s usually integrated:
Concept modules (on the internet or in-particular person) about security, Understanding psychology, and aquatic growth.
In-pool workshops for palms-on instructing exercise.
Mentored instructing periods where you use Everything you’ve realized with actual swimmers.

Are there distinct levels of swim training skills?
Indeed, and that’s where things get remarkable. When you finally’ve obtained your base certification, you are able to specialise further:
Toddler and Preschool Aquatics – instructing babies and toddlers (often with mom and dad from the drinking water).
Adults and Adolescents – encouraging more mature learners conquer their concern or refine their strokes.
Access and Inclusion – equipping you to show folks with disabilities or particular requires.
Aggressive Stroke Advancement – a step nearer to coaching for swim squads.
Each and every specialisation opens up new possibilities — both of those professionally and personally. Some instructors even go into swim college coordination or aquatic application management.
How can I keep certified?
Your AUSTSWIM licence requires renewal every single three yrs. Which means maintaining your CPR certification and finishing professional progress hours. Visualize it considerably less as admin and much more as keeping present — for the reason that swimming tactics, safety criteria, and teaching approaches evolve just like any career.
Numerous instructors select small refresher workshops or skill-up programs made available from AUSTSWIM and also other countrywide vendors. Being up-to-day keeps your training sharp and your employability strong.

Q: Do I want a Dealing with Small children Look at?
Yes. Anybody educating minors in Australia have to keep a legitimate Working with Young children Check out (WWCC) suitable for their condition or territory.
